Stefan Monnier <monnier@iro.umontreal.ca> writes:
> But `point-at-bol` is a function imported from XEmacs where they don't
> have fields, AFAIK.
It's an alias for `line-beginning-position', so some of the places where
it's used are expecting the semantics that `line-beginning-position' has
now.
(The function originated in XEmacs, was imported to Emacs and renamed
because of course, and was then given different semantics.)
